Activist and author Zoleka Mandela who is fighting cancer for the third time revealed this morning that she was admitted to hospital after collapsing on the morning of Saturday, May 20, 2023.
“This is a very hard one for me,” shared Mandela who collapsed at home due to another tumour found in her brain. The author admits that things are not “looking good” for her at all. Despite this, she promises to be “honest about her journey” as she “vowed” she would for the “betterment of the cancer community.”
Mandela asks the people to join her in prayer.
“I ask for your continued prayers, not for me but MORE for My Blings ( My Riches: Zondwa, Lindo, Bambatha and Zwelabo), for my Queenship (Those who have been there every step of the way: Thatohatsi, Jenine, Sanele, Jabulani and Sisipho), as well as My Assistant Mom, Aus’ Lerato who has been good to me and good for me, and most importantly my children – the very best of me, my lifeline and anchor: (Zwelami, Zanyiwe, Zenzile and Zingce).
“As I rejoin you in prayer, for them all, I will pray for my comfort, peace acceptance. Thanking you all for your prayer, well wishes, hope, support and encouragement.”

Fortunately, a few days ago Mandela revealed that she was discharged from the hospital after spending eight nights there.
“I can’t believe I was admitted for eight nights and now, finally sleeping in my own bed,” enthused Mandela.
“So thankful for the dedication, outstanding efforts, and selfless contributions of the entire Oncology Department, together with the Occupational Therapy team, Palliative Care Department, Physio team, and an incredibly dynamic team of Doctors. I’M HOME, I’M HOME, I’M HOME!!! Peace. Passion. Positivity.”
